Saturday the 19th June saw the who’s who of West Australian Formula 500 racers, supporters and sponsors converge on Ascot Quays for the presentation of awards to the many people who participated in the 2009/10 season. An impressive crowd of over 100 people were on hand and many were impressed with the amount of planning that had gone into an entertaining night, celebrating the highs and lows of an action packed year for everyone involved.
Steven Ellement needed to bring a trailer for all his trophies as expected taking out the WA State Title at Northam, 1st in the West Coast Series, Tied best presented car with Jeff Hedington, The Drivers driver award, the Fairest and Best and also was presented with the clean sweep award for winning all heats and the feature in one night (West Coast Rnd 1) along with Daniel Harding (West Coast Rnd 6). Other winners on the night included Cody Turacchio who received the Hard Charger award after passing 13 cars in the WA State title final, Matt Watkins got the nod for the Chief Stewards award, Best presented car and crew went to Jeff Hedington, the Encouragement award went to veteran racer Bryan Mullings and Most Improved driver was taken out by Todd Nathan. Trevor Harding Jnr was the obvious choice for Rookie of the Year with some great performances including winning the 2010 Bunny Burrowes Memorial, a great first up performance at the 2010 Australian Title in Alice Springs which was taken out by his brother Daniel in fine style and several podium finishes at the Motorplex and West Coast rounds.
Committee members Cate Bott and Deb Smith were presented with flowers for their outstanding services to the division. Deb attended all West Coast rounds as the Judge timekeeper and also has her hands full as secretary of Formula 500’s WA for the first time this season while Cate fulfilled the position of Liaison Officer this year which will prove to be an important role in coming months as we move forward with track negotiations for our upcoming season which already unofficially is looking to be our best yet. Congratulations to all people who received awards and a huge thank you has to go to committee members Dave Hedington, Brad Warwick, Cate Bott and Deb Smith for doing all of the organizing that went into the night. A special thanks also to Ross “Hollywood” Heywood for being the guest DJ for the night and Jason Priolo for putting together a great compilation of the seasons highlights displayed on the big screen for all to enjoy.
